WebAug 12, 2024 · The solution for this mistake is to understand the difference between a question and a declarative sentence. Declarative sentences make a statement: “I wonder who wrote The Book of Love.”. When you write a declarative sentence, regardless of the words in that sentence, you are not asking a question. Summary of Question Marks: Use a question mark at the end of a direct question. Do not use a question mark at the end of an indirect question. WebQuestion marks usually go after the last letter in a sentence. Like other punctuation marks, question marks stay with the text they refer to. Usually, this is immediately after the last letter of the last word of the sentence. ... Depending on the context, a rhetorical question can end in a question mark or an exclamation mark. WebThe general rule is that a sentence ends with only one terminal punctuation mark. There are three options: Period. Question mark. Exclamation point. There are enough exceptions to this general rule, however, to warrant the following chart, which shows nearly all of the scenarios you are likely to face. Most authorities, including The Chicago ... WebIf your sentence is half-statement, half-question, or a rhetorical question, it is your decision whether to conclude with a period or question mark. Ending these with a period can help show that the speaker is tired: Why don't you kids knock it off. Ending them with a question mark usually means the speaker is expecting an answer:

When a direct question occurs within a larger sentence, cap the direct question with a question mark. This applies if the sentence ends with a direct question, or even if the direct question gets embedded into an early portion of the sentence. In either case, place a question mark after the direct question. Sentence-ending question:
